The Bass Rock does indeed have a definite pong close up.Considering the white coating I'll let you work out what it is.I'm not particularly into bird watching(ornithology that is!) but a boat trip to the rock on a nice day is spectacular even though we didn't actually set foot on it.There are thousands of Gannets and other sea birds living there.Also North Berwick is the home of the Scottish Sea Bird Centre as well as being a very pleasant town.Best Wishes EricT
